If you think your gaming rig is awesome, check out this beast of a setup, which includes $30,000 of hardware. Complete with a three-screen driving simulator and a 42-inch LG LCD monitor connected to a beast of a gaming rig. Watch the video after the jump to see it in action.
“Here is my new gaming room comprising of all the hardware I have gathered for the last few years. I made a custom wall-to-wall desk. The 42-inch LG will be replaced by the Dell U3011 and the GTX580s with the new GTX680 Hydro coppers when they are released. Obviously, I didn’t spend 30k in one hit, but it did add up to that in the end!”
The room has been created by YouTube user Maxishine who published a video of the creation and hardware on YouTube this week, with 10 x 3TB drives of storage.

Future Upgrades and Enhancements
Maxishine’s commitment to keeping his setup at the cutting edge of technology is evident in his plans for future upgrades. The replacement of the 42-inch LG monitor with the Dell U3011 is a significant enhancement. The Dell U3011 is known for its superior color accuracy, higher resolution, and better overall performance, making it a perfect choice for a high-end gaming setup.
The upgrade from GTX580 to GTX680 Hydro coppers is another major improvement. The GTX680 Hydro coppers are water-cooled graphics cards that offer better performance and stability, especially during long gaming sessions. This upgrade will not only enhance the visual experience but also ensure that the system remains cool and efficient.
